This is our second time back since they reopened and unfortunately, it was not a great experience. The weather was a little overcast, so it was VERY slow for a Friday evening. Maybe five tables total. We stood at the host stand for a couple minutes before finally poking our heads inside because no one ever came out. Three servers were standing there chatting. When we asked to sit outside so we could watch our kids play, they did bus the one empty table, but then we sat for ten minutes with no menus and no one taking our order. When he did come around- it took another five minutes for him to bring menus and then another ten before he came back to get our order and drink order. The server at the table next to us argued with the couple there that nachos were not on special for happy hour. Which is in contradiction to the ad that is all over Facebook. Our server forgot our kids drinks and our frog dip. When ten more minutes went by with nothing, my husband went inside to ask, and again he was standing there chatting. When he did bring their drinks (kids cups with lids), no straws. Food was just okay… I got the Texan plate. My carne guisada and refried beans had a few crusty bits and weren’t warm. My husband’s quesadillas were only filled halfway with meat and cheese- so lots of bites were just tortilla. Super sad because we are local. I grew up coming to Adobe Verde. Even under new management, it’s not up to the old standard. We were excited about another spot with a playground for the kiddos, but we will take our business to Herbert’s instead.

As a New Braunfels native, this place has gone way downhill. I heard they were making changes and I decided to try it but it was terrible. We stopped in specifically because their menu on their website shows they have a chile relleno, but we got there and were told that they actually didn’t have that and that the menu had changed. Chips taste like they’re out of a bag and salsa was watered down and there was almost no flavor. Decided to try a small queso because that had to be better than the salsa but it was also watery and had almost no flavor. My friend got the crispy chicken tacos and said they were just okay, but the rice was so salty it was inedible. I got the asada fries thinking that they couldn't mess that up but the cheese wasn't melted cheese like I thought it would be, it was the same weird watery cheese that the queso was made with and the asada was super tough and tasted gamey. Considering their new, higher prices, I definitely recommend going elsewhere as New Braunfels has Mexican restaurants that are significantly better than this one. If you’re just visiting and you’re in Gruene, venture outside of Gruene just a bit and there are tons of more authentic and better tasting Mexican restaurants nearby.

I miss the old Verde. I was craving the “famous” Frog Dip and was super excited to try the new and improved Adobe. We stopped in around 2 on a Saturday as a group of 4. Our server mixed up our drink orders multiple times. No big deal. The margaritas were not fully frozen. No biggie. We had to ask multiple times to get napkins and we were never brought or offered water. Whatever, maybe they’re short staffed. But boy, the food was subpar. The frog dip is nothing like the original - it’s runny, and had a layer of oil sitting on top. The original frog dip was thick, with substance to it. The flavor was not even close to correct. The chips were obviously not made in house, and the salsa was flavorless. I ordered the flautas and they were good, though the beans tasted (and looked) like they came straight out of a can. Overall, it was a disappointment. There are so many other tex mex options in NB, I don’t think we’ll be back. Total bummer because the renovation looks nice, and the location has a great history behind it.
